INTRODUCTION
Here is my 1989 Bronco II XL 4x4.

It has a rebuilt 2.9L V6 engine (Jan. 2000), a rebuilt 5-speed manual transmission (Oct. 2003) and new paint and graphics (April 2003). I added a James Duff stage III 3" suspension lift (Progressive Rate coil springs, Axle pivot drop brackets, Radius arm bushings, Rear axle U-bolts, Coil Tower & Dual Shock Mounts, Shocks with blue boots (4 front, 2 rear), Long Link Radius Arms, Leaf springs, lifted), a 2" body lift, along with the prerunner bumper, Warn manual locking hubs and a Flowmaster exhaust, all sitting on 33x12.5 Mickey Thompson Baja Claw Radials with 15x10 Mickey Thompson Classic II wheels. The graphics were done by my cousin (robradikal) who is a graphic artist. He used vinyl stickers, so far they have held up nice, even through the mud.

UPDATED MODS
1. 2" body lift and replace body mounts (09/15/04)
2. 33x12.5 MT Baja Claw Radials on 15x 10 MT Classic IIs (10/08/04)
3. Dana 35 axle swap (01/01/05)
4. 4.56 Precision Gears (02/10/05)
5. Detroit Locker in rear (02/10/05)
6. 4.0L V6 engine swap (in progress)
